It appears that Daniel Carcillo's issue is a knee injury, which is expected to sideline him for about one month. There are some bright sides, though. It's his right knee, not a recently surgically repaired left one. Also, he isn't expected to go under the knife. Carcillo isn't a big-time contributor, although the possibility of landing with high-end teammates makes him occasional watch list material, if nothing else.

Daniel Carcillo is out with what's believed to be a leg injury. Carcillo sustained the injury in the third period of Saturday's contest. "Danny is going to miss some time here," coach Joel Quenneville said. "We'll know more exactly about the time frame by (Sunday)." Carcillo was playing in his first game since Jan. 2, 2011. He underwent knee surgery to repair his ACL last year.

Daniel Carcillo has been skating alongside Jonathan Toews and Marian Hossa. "Cars is an energy player," Hossa said. "Basically, he can go hard to the net and get extra room for the chances, so it's going to work out great for us. He gets his feet going and he's really a huge key in our line because he makes room for us." Carcillo figures to get a ton of penalty minutes, but he might also break the 20-point mark if he can stay on a scoring line this season.

Daniel Carcillo got plenty of extra time to recover form a torn ACL in his right knee due to the lockout. Carcillo underwent surgery in January 2012. "Everything feels good," he said. "It's been a long year and I'm definitely excited to get started. Getting back into game shape now is my big concern -- the stops, the starts, coming off the turns and that sort of thing." Carcillo, like all players, will only get a week of training camp with no exhibition games before the season starts. Consequently, he's likely to be one of the many players that's rusty at the start of the season.

Daniel Carcillo is looking forward to the start of the NHL season as he has recovered from a torn ACL in his right knee and subsequent surgery in January. Carcillo is also looking to change his image as an enforcer, an image that has been shown to be true with 1068 penalty minutes in 310 career NHL games, and become a complete hockey player. "I've been feeling I have something to prove my whole career, to be honest," Carcillo said. "I came in and I got pigeonholed into a certain role which is obviously not what I want to be known for ultimately. There's always room to improve and get better and prove to myself more than anything that I can be an effective player and a useful tool in any situation on any team." Carcillo has shown some scoring touch and could score 20 goals in a full NHL season in the right circumstances.

Daniel Carcillo has purchased a $640,000 penthouse in Lincoln Park, Chicago. Of course, the NHL is locked out so Carcillo isn't getting paid right now, but he did make $775,000 last season and $1.075 million in 2010-11. Carcillo has signed with the Chicago Blackhawks through 2013-14, so it makes sense that he'd want to get comfortable in Chicago.

The Chicago Blackhawk players have hired Chicago Wolves skating and skills coach Kenny McCudden to run their practices during the lockout. Players like Jonathan Toews and Jamal Mayers were doing double duty as they were playing and trying to run an organized practice so the addition of McCudden will help. "He's awesome. His drills are great," Daniel Carcillo said. "As you can see there aren't many guys out here but he keeps the line moving. They aren't the same drills so it's not redundant. It's not too hard; but it's a lot of puck-handling and things you need to sharpen up and the other stuff will come if and when we get back to work."

Daniel Carcillo (knee) is still skating with some of his teammates despite the fact that the players are locked out. Carcillo is recovering from his January knee surgery. "It feels good to be out with everyone," Carcillo said. "I feel sluggish. I haven't skated all that much lately. It's good to be back and get going again and be out with some of my teammates." Carcillo might be ready for the start of the season, assuming we get a new CBA before any regular season games get canceled.

Daniel Carcillo is almost completely recovered from his January knee surgery. "I've been in the clear to do everything and start pushing it. It's been going well," Carcillo said. He says he feels stronger than ever and should be ready for the start of training camp. He might end up among the league leaders in penalty minutes while providing fantasy owners with modest contributions offensively.

Daniel Carcillo, who underwent surgery back in January to reconstruct the ACL in his left knee, has resumed skating. "(Carcillo) is close to 100 percent," GM Stan Bowman said. "He would certainly be ready to roll even if training camp were to start in a week or two." He appeared in only 28 games with the Hawks in 2011-12, while recording 11 points and 82 penalty minutes. He should be able to provide points and PIMs next year if he is given a regular roster spot by Chicago.
